This sketch of the Eendracht windmill in Gorinchem, was made by George Hendrik Breitner using graphite on paper. Here, the artist uses a readily available and inexpensive material, making the sketch an accessible medium for capturing everyday scenes. Breitner’s choice of graphite allows for quick, fluid lines, evident in the sketch's spontaneous and unfinished quality. The texture of the paper, though subtle, adds depth to the drawing, catching the graphite in its fibers to create tonal variations. The sketchiness and simplicity suggests immediacy, as though Breitner captured the scene en plein air. The choice to use a simple material like graphite, democratizes the artistic process. In doing so, Breitner blurs the lines between fine art and everyday practice. This approach elevates the mundane to the artistic, inviting us to reconsider the value and artistry found in commonplace materials and scenes.
